Would you people invest in NXT ?
I see a feature in NXT but I don't really like their distribution

I see NXT as just another coin. I agree that their distribution is pretty lopsided. One thing I would like to stress is that its hard to "invest" in most coins, as most coins are created to be investment vehicles.

Lets take Darkcoin or Blackcoin for example. The only time I would use those coins is if I ever needed to conduct a transaction in that denomination. Otherwise, I am just taking on risk holding on to the coin, just like any other. Most business is conducting in BTC anyways so the only other reason for me to hold those coins is for speculation.

My investment style doesn't include coins like BC or Dark. I have lost out on plenty of profit from not speculating on these coins, but for every moon rocket like BC or DARK, you have 10 failed launches like WC or FAC. Chances are that I will strike out more times than not, which would leave me with a smaller account every time.

The reason why I like Hobonickels is because I understand one of its purposes. Its a financial tool to generate growth. The risk and reward is not as skewed as with other coins.

These are the reasons why I don't "invest" in NXT.
